## Product: Cuisinart 4 Slice Toaster Oven CPT-180P1
**Brand:** Cuisinart

## Pros
- Toasts bread and bagels evenly with consistent browning results, avoiding burnt spots.
- Reliable performance with multiple toast settings: bagel, defrost, reheat, and cancel for versatile use.
- Durable stainless steel construction combines sleek retro style and solid build quality.
- Can toast up to four slices at once, making it practical for small families or quick breakfasts.
- Precise toasting control with two heat level knobs and multiple browning options.
- Separate crumb trays for each side simplify cleaning and show thoughtful design.
- Compact size fits nicely on the countertop without taking up too much space.
- Reheat function warms frozen bread effectively without sacrificing taste or texture.
- Positive locking mechanism on the toaster levers adds to sturdy, satisfying operation.
- Overall, users highly recommend it for daily use, some even report a decade of reliable performance.

## Cons
- Buttons for special functions require firm presses and can cause the toaster to shift if placed on an uneven surface.
- Knobs have some play and need a bit of pressure toward the unit for better grip and accurate adjustment.
- Crumb trays are accessed from the back, which some find less convenient than front removal.
- Fingerprints and oil smudges show easily on the brushed stainless steel surface.
- Strong chemical smell on first use, so running it empty on high heat outdoors beforehand is advised.
- Operates on 120V with a US plug, which may be incompatible outside North America; using a voltage converter is not recommended due to high wattage (1800W), so regional compatibility is critical.
- Warranty registration feels confusing and more like a marketing sign-up than a straightforward process.

## Bottom Line

The Cuisinart 4 Slice Toaster Oven (CPT-180P1) impresses with its blend of classic looks, solid stainless steel durability, and reliable, even toasting performance for multiple bread types. It’s a great choice if you want a compact, versatile toaster oven to handle up to four slices at once with precision browning. Just be aware of minor usability quirks like button firmness and crumb tray placement, plus the crucial voltage compatibility if you’re outside the US. If you’re looking for a toaster oven that balances style and everyday functionality without breaking the bank, this is a solid pick.

If you need something with easier crumb access or different voltage options, be sure to explore other models in your region for the best fit.
